LYCIAN WAY - HIKING BETWEEN ANCIENT RUINS AND TURQUOISE WATERS

The Lycian Way is one of the most beautiful long-distance hiking trails in the world – and you’re right in the middle of it. This coastal trek offers the best of both worlds: the glittering Mediterranean Sea at your feet and the majestic peaks of the Taurus Mountains on the horizon.

Day by day, you follow trails that wind high above the sea, offering spectacular views of rugged cliffs and mountains reaching up to 3,000 meters. Inland, you’ll pass through fragrant pine forests, silvery olive groves, and the typical Mediterranean scrub – a landscape that invites you to breathe deeply and marvel.

You’ll hike through small, traditional villages, experience warm Turkish hospitality, and feel the deep connection to history: this path was once a major trade route in ancient times. Today, impressive rock tombs and abandoned ruins bear witness to the rich cultural heritage of the region.

Look forward to a week of hiking filled with nature, history, and unforgettable moments – along one of Turkey’s most captivating coastlines.

TOUR ITINERARY

Day 1: Arrival

You fly to Antalya, where we’ll pick you up and take you to your accommodation. Overnight stay in Antalya

 

Day 2: The Eternal Flames of Chimera

A short transfer takes you to Ulupınar. From a trout farm, you hike down to a stream, which you may need to cross barefoot depending on the water level. After a gentle climb, you’ll enjoy sweeping views over the bay of Çıralı. Then it’s downhill to the mystical flames of Chimera and onward to the village. Overnight stay in Çıralı. WT: approx. 3.5 hrs

 

Day 3: From Olympos to Adrasan

Today you explore the ruins of the ancient coastal city of Olympos – with temples, baths, and an acropolis perched on a rocky outcrop. You then hike through Mediterranean scrub and strawberry tree forests along the slopes of Musa Dağı, passing citrus orchards on your way to Adrasan Bay. Overnight stay in Adrasan. WT: approx. 6–7 hrs

 

Day 4: Gelidonya Lighthouse

One of the most scenic stages of the Lycian Way awaits you. From Gelidonya Lighthouse, you’ll enjoy breathtaking views of the Chelidonia Islands. With the glittering sea always in sight, you hike through fragrant pine forests back to Adrasan. Overnight stay in Adrasan. WT: approx. 6–7 hrs

 

Day 5: Simena and Üçağız

After a transfer to Kapaklı, you hike to the ruins of Istlada. The trail continues along the stunning coastline of Kekova to Simena Castle – well worth a visit! You then reach the charming harbor village of Üçağız. Overnight stay in Üçağız. WT: approx. 4 hrs

 

Day 6: Coastal Hike to Aperlai

A short transfer takes you to the trailhead above Kılıçlı. You hike across hills covered with oak and carob trees to the ruins of Aperlai, where the sea reaches deep into the ancient city. A narrow coastal path leads you back to Üçağız. Overnight stay in Üçağız. WT: approx. 5 hrs

 

Day 7: Myra and Return to Antalya

Today you visit the impressive rock-cut tombs of Myra and the Byzantine Church of St. Nicholas in Demre. Afterwards, you return to Antalya by public bus (approx. 3 hrs) or optional private transfer.
Overnight stay in Antalya. 

 

Day 8: Departure

Transfer to Antalya Airport and return flight.

DIFFICULTY LEVEL

Well-marked hiking trails, often with rocky or uneven terrain.
Daily walking times range from 4 to 7 hours.
Maximum ascent: 800 m | Maximum descent: 800 m
